Andrey Dudov (Moscow, RCF) finished 5-4 in the 10-team qualifying round. . In their opening game, Dudov lost 8-7 to Matthew Neilson (Naseby, NZL), then responded with a 8-5 win over James Craik (Aberdeen, SCO). Dudov won 6-4 against Giacomo Colli (Trentino, ITA), then won 7-4 against Luc Violette (Lake Stevens, USA). Dudov went on to lose 10-9 against Yves Wagenseil (Bern, SUI). Dudov lost 10-6 to Sixten Totzek (Hamburg, GER) where Dudov responded with a 8-7 win over Eirik Oey (Oslo, NOR). Dudov went on to lose 6-1 against Jacques Gauthier (Winnipeg, CAN). Dudov responded with a 6-4 win over Daniel Magnusson (Karlstad, SWE) in their final qualifying round match.
Dudov earned 6.600 world rankings points for their preliminary round wins.
